Kuinka pelastaa, korjata ja asentaa uudelleen GRUB Boot Loader Ubuntussa


Tämä opetusohjelma opastaa sinua pelastamaan, korjaamaan tai asentamaan uudelleen vaurioituneen Ubuntu-koneen, jota ei voida käynnistää, koska Grub2-käynnistyslatain on vaarantunut, eikä se voi ladata käynnistyslatainta, joka siirtää ohjauksen edelleen Linux-ytimeen. Kaikissa nykyaikaisissa Linux-käyttöjärjestelmissä GRUB on oletuskäynnistyslataaja.

Tämä menettely on testattu onnistuneesti Ubuntu 16.04 -palvelinversiossa, jonka Grub-käynnistyslatain on vaurioitunut. Tämä opetusohjelma kattaa kuitenkin vain Ubuntu-palvelimen GRUB-pelastusmenettelyn, vaikka samaa menettelyä voidaan soveltaa menestyksekkäästi mihin tahansa Ubuntu-järjestelmään tai useimpiin Debian-pohjaisiin jakeluihin.

Vaatimukset

    1. Lataa Ubuntu Server Edition DVS ISO -kuva

Yrität käynnistää Ubuntu-palvelinkoneesi ja huomaat, että käyttöjärjestelmät eivät enää käynnisty ja huomaat, että käynnistyslatausohjelma ei enää toimi?

Tyypillisesti GNU GRUB -minimikonsoli näkyy näytölläsi alla olevan kuvakaappauksen mukaisesti. Kuinka voit palauttaa Grubin Ubuntussa?

Linuxissa on monia menetelmiä, joita voidaan käyttää rikkinäisen grubin uudelleenasentamiseen, joihinkin voi liittyä kyky työskennellä ja palauttaa käynnistyslatain Linuxin komentorivin avulla ja toiset ovat melko yksinkertaisia ja edellyttävät laitteiston käynnistämistä Linux live CD ja GUI-osoitteiden käyttäminen vaurioituneen käynnistyslataimen korjaamiseen.

Yksi yksinkertaisimmista menetelmistä, joita voidaan käyttää Debian-pohjaisissa jakeluissa, erityisesti Ubuntu-järjestelmissä, on tässä opetusohjelmassa esitetty menetelmä, joka sisältää vain koneen käynnistämisen Ubuntu live DVD ISO -otostiedostoon.

ISO-kuvan voi ladata seuraavasta linkistä: http://releases.ubuntu.com/

Asenna Ubuntu GRUB Boot Loader uudelleen

1. Kun olet ladannut ja polttanut Ubuntu ISO -kuvan tai luonut käynnistettävän USB-tikun, aseta käynnistysmedia sopivaan koneasemaan, käynnistä kone uudelleen ja anna ohjeita BIOS käynnistääksesi Ubuntun live-kuvan.

2. Valitse ensimmäisessä näytössä kieli ja jatka painamalla [Enter]-näppäintä.

3. Paina seuraavassa näytössä F6-toimintonäppäintä avataksesi muiden asetusten valikon ja valitse Asiantuntija-tilavaihtoehto. Paina sitten Escape-näppäintä palataksesi Käynnistysasetukset-riville muokkaustilassa, kuten alla olevissa kuvakaappauksissa näkyy.

4. Muokkaa seuraavaksi Ubuntun live-kuvan käynnistysasetuksia siirtämällä kohdistin näppäimistön nuolinäppäimillä juuri ennen hiljaista-merkkijonoa ja kirjoita seuraava järjestys alla olevan kuvakaappauksen mukaisesti.

rescue/enable=true 

5. Kun olet kirjoittanut yllä olevan lausunnon, paina [Enter]-näppäintä ohjataksesi live-ISO-kuvan käynnistymään pelastustilaan rikkinäisen järjestelmän pelastamiseksi.

6. Valitse seuraavassa näytössä kieli, jolla haluat suorittaa järjestelmän pelastamisen, ja jatka painamalla [enter]-näppäintä.

7. Valitse seuraavaksi sopiva sijaintisi esitetystä luettelosta ja paina [enter]-näppäintä siirtyäksesi eteenpäin.

8. Valitse seuraavassa näyttösarjassa näppäimistöasettelu alla olevien kuvakaappausten mukaisesti

9. Kun olet havainnut koneen laitteiston, ladannut joitain lisäkomponentteja ja määrittänyt verkon, sinua pyydetään määrittämään koneesi isäntänimi. Koska et asenna järjestelmää, jätä järjestelmän isäntänimi oletukseksi ja jatka painamalla [enter].

10. Seuraavaksi asennusohjelman kuva havaitsee aikavyöhykkeesi toimitetun fyysisen sijainnin perusteella. Tämä asetus toimii tarkasti vain, jos laitteesi on yhteydessä Internetiin.

Sillä ei kuitenkaan ole merkitystä, jos aikavyöhykettäsi ei tunnisteta oikein, koska et suorita järjestelmän asennusta. Jatka vain painamalla Kyllä.

11. Seuraavalla näytöllä sinut siirretään suoraan pelastustilaan. Täällä sinun tulee valita koneen juuritiedostojärjestelmä toimitetusta luettelosta. Jos asennettu järjestelmäsi käyttää loogista taltiohallintaa osioiden rajaamiseen, juuri--osion pitäisi olla helppo havaita luettelosta tarkastelemalla taltioryhmien nimet alla olevan kuvakaappauksen mukaisesti.

Muussa tapauksessa, jos et ole varma, mitä osiota /(root)-tiedostojärjestelmässä käytetään, sinun tulee yrittää tutkia jokaista osiota, kunnes löydät juuritiedostojärjestelmän. Kun olet valinnut juuriosion, jatka painamalla [Enter]-näppäintä.

12. Jos järjestelmäsi on asennettu erillisellä /boot-osiolla, asennusohjelma kysyy, haluatko liittää erillisen /boot-osion > osio. Valitse Kyllä ja jatka painamalla [Enter]-näppäintä.

13. Seuraavaksi sinulle tarjotaan Pelastustoimet-valikko. Valitse tässä vaihtoehto Asenna GRUB-käynnistyslataaja uudelleen ja jatka painamalla [enter]-näppäintä.

14. Kirjoita seuraavassa näytössä koneen levylaite, johon GRUB asennetaan, ja jatka painamalla [Enter] alla olevan kuvan mukaisesti.

Yleensä sinun tulee asentaa käynnistyslatain koneen ensimmäiselle kiintolevylle MBR, joka on useimmissa tapauksissa /dev/sda. GRUB:n asennusprosessi alkaa heti, kun painat Enter-näppäintä.

15. Kun käytössä oleva järjestelmä on asentanut GRUB-käynnistyslataimen, sinut ohjataan takaisin rescue mode -päävalikkoon. Kun olet korjannut GRUBin onnistuneesti, enää jäljellä on vain käynnistää kone alla olevien kuvien mukaisesti.

Poista lopuksi live-käynnistysmedia sopivasta asemasta, käynnistä kone uudelleen ja sinun pitäisi pystyä käynnistämään asennettu käyttöjärjestelmä. Ensimmäisenä ilmestyvän näytön pitäisi olla asennetun käyttöjärjestelmän GRUB-valikko, kuten alla olevassa kuvakaappauksessa näkyy.

Asenna Ubuntu Grub Boot Loader manuaalisesti uudelleen

14. Jos kuitenkin haluat asentaa GRUB-käynnistyslataimen manuaalisesti uudelleen Pelastustoiminnot-valikosta, noudata kaikkia tässä opetusohjelmassa esitettyjä vaiheita, kunnes saavutat kohdan 13, jossa seuraavat muutokset: sen sijaan, että valitsisit GRUB-käynnistyslataimen uudelleenasentamisen, valitse vaihtoehto Suorita komentotulkki /dev/(your_chosen_root_partition) ja paina [Enter]-näppäintä jatkaa.

15. Napsauta seuraavassa näytössä Jatka painamalla [enter]-näppäintä avataksesi komentotulkin juuritiedostojärjestelmäosiossa.

16. Kun komentotulkki on avattu juuritiedostojärjestelmässä, suorita ls-komento alla esitetyllä tavalla tunnistaaksesi koneen kiintolevylaitteet.

ls /dev/sd* 

Kun olet tunnistanut oikean kiintolevylaitteen (yleensä ensimmäisen levyn tulee olla /dev/sda), anna seuraava komento asentaaksesi GRUB-käynnistyslataimen tunnistetun kiintolevyn MBR:lle.

grub-install /dev/sda

Kun GRUB on asennettu onnistuneesti, poistu komentotulkkikehotteesta kirjoittamalla exit.

exit

17. Kun olet poistunut komentotulkkikehotteesta, palaat rescue mode -päävalikkoon. Valitse tässä vaihtoehto käynnistetään uudelleen järjestelmä, poistetaan live-käynnistettävä ISO-otos ja asennetun käyttöjärjestelmän pitäisi käynnistyä ilman ongelmia.

Siinä kaikki! Pienellä vaivalla olet onnistuneesti tehnyt Ubuntu-koneellesi mahdollisuuden käynnistää asennettu käyttöjärjestelmä.